5th Grade Science Research Project Rubric

2019 Science Research Project Rubric

5th Grade

 

While typing your Science Research project, please make a title page.  In the center of the first page, please include your name, date, and name of the invention.  Use a standard font with the text size (14) for your paper.  You may use a larger text size for your title page.  Remember to double-space your work.

 

The order of your paper is the title page, purpose, materials, research, procedure, diagram, conclusion, thank you note, and bibliography.  Make a heading for each part of your paper.  The heading should be on the left side of the page for each description.  You need to bold your heading.  Each part of your paper needs to follow each other.   Points will be deducted if your research paper is not in the correct order.

 

At the top of your paper, you will need to type out your purpose.  Your purpose needs to be clear and state why someone or something would you use your invention.   See the purpose in your organization packet.

 

You will earn 5 points by clearly writing the purpose of the invention in your paper.  You will earn 2.5 points by providing an incomplete purpose for the invention or a purpose that is unclear.  You will earn no points for not providing a purpose.

 

The next step will be to type a list of materials and any amounts used for the invention.   See materials that you listed in the organization packet.  You may have added new materials since researching the invention.

 

You will earn 5 points for your list of materials.  You will earn 2.5 points if noticeable materials are missing.  No points will be given if you do not provide any materials.

 

Additionally, a research section was sent home in the organization packet.  You need to have at least three quotes from three different sources in your research section.  (One source must be an interview and two additional sources must be from other forms of sources like Internet sources).  You may have more than three sources.   You need to follow the correct format, while giving credit to each source.  Look over the research sheets.  You also need to work on describing information from your quotes.  

 

You will earn 30 points for providing research and have three different sources – one being an interview and two additional sources must be from other forms of sources like Internet sources.  You will earn 20 points for incorporating research and have two different sources.  You will earn 10 points for incorporating research and have only used one source in your research paper.  No points will be given if you do not provide any research.   Points will be deducted if you do not follow the correct format of giving any source credit.  Points will also be deducted if you do not make an attempt to work on describing information from your quotes.

 

Points will be deducted if there is no information from an interview source.  You must have at least two additional sources besides an interview source.  If you do not have at least two additional sources besides an interview source, points will be deducted.

 

The next part of your project will be the procedure.  You need to review your procedure sheet that was sent home.  Check over that you listed in numerical order or bullet points the steps for how the invention is put together.

 

You will earn 20 points in your paper for a detailed procedure that explains the invention from beginning, middle, and end typing the steps in numerical order or bullet points.  You will receive 15 points for a procedure of the invention that provides a description of each part of your procedure in numerical order or bullet points, but your information is somewhat unclear.  You will receive 10 points for a procedure in numerical order or bullet points that is mostly unclear of how to put the invention together.  Finally, a procedure that provides few details in numerical order or bullet points to explain the invention will receive 5 points.  No points will be given if you do not provide a procedure for the invention.

 

You will need to have drawn a diagram of the invention.  Your diagram needs to be clearly labeled with at least six different things for the invention.  Your diagram and words labeled needs to be gone over using colored pencils or markers.

 

You will earn 18 points for a diagram of the invention that is drawn and is clearly labeled with at least six different things for the invention   You will earn 16 points for a diagram of the invention that is drawn and is labeled with five different things for the invention.  You will earn 14 points for a diagram of the invention that is drawn and is labeled with four different things for the invention.  You will earn 12 points for a diagram of the invention that is drawn and is labeled with three different things for the invention.  You will earn 10 points for a diagram of the invention that is drawn and is labeled with two different things for the invention.  You will earn 8 points for a diagram of the invention that is drawn and is labeled with only one thing for the invention.  A diagram of the invention with nothing labeled will only earn 6 points.  You will lose an additional three points if the diagram and descriptions labeled for the invention is not gone over using colored pencils or markers.

 

You will earn no points if there is no diagram of the invention.

 

Next, you will need a conclusion for your project.  You need to review your conclusion sheet that was sent home.  Check over that you provided a description for each of the points of your conclusion.

 

You will earn 15 points for a conclusion that describes a complete description of how the invention helped you learn more about science.  It also contains a complete description of how the invention helped shape people’s lives.  You will earn 13  points for a conclusion that is mostly complete, but is missing a supporting sentence.  You will earn 10 points for a conclusion that has some information, but is missing two supporting sentences.  You will earn 7.5 points for a conclusion that is half complete, and is missing three supporting sentences.  You will earn 5 points for a conclusion with little information and only contains two sentences.   Finally, you will earn 2 points for a conclusion that provides very little information.  No points will be given if you do not provide a conclusion.

 

After your conclusion, remember to include a short description of any people you would like to thank that helped you with your Science Research project.  This includes people that helped you at home, at school, or any other locations.

 

You will earn 4 points for completing your short description of people that helped you with your Science Research project.  No points will be earned if this part of the Science Research project is incomplete.

 

Remember to check over your typed paper for spelling errors. 

 

You will earn 15 points for a completed paper with no spelling errors.  You will earn 12 points for a completed paper with a few (1-2) spelling errors.  You will earn 8 points for a paper with some (3-5) spelling errors.   You will 4 points for a paper with   many spelling errors (6 errors or more).

 

 

Students worked on a bibliography page.  Students will use the bibliography sheet provided.

 

You will earn 18 points for having at least three sources.  You will earn 12 points for including two sources on your bibliography sheet.  You will earn 6 points for including one source on your bibliography sheet.  No points will be given if there is no bibliography attached to your Science Research project.  Points will be deducted if the format is not completed correctly for one or more sources. 

 

You will lose 6 points if you do not have an interview source.  You must also have at least two additional sources besides an interview source.  If you do not have at least two additional sources besides an interview source, you will lose 6 points.
